Input Bias Current (IB) and Input Offset Current (IOS).The dc current sources I B1 and I B2 model the input bias current at each input terminal of the op amp, with I B1 =I B + I OS 2 and I B2 =I B I OS where I B and I OS are, respectively, the input bias current and the input offset current specified by the op-amp manufacturer.
